
Every Saturday, a particular community holds a ‘Puzzle’ event to raise money for a new Leisure Centre. Competitors attempt to solve a puzzle as quickly as possible. Last Saturday, 600 competitors took part. The times taken to complete the puzzle were normally distributed with mean 32.4 minutes and standard deviation 2.5 minutes. 80 competitors who took part in this Saturday’s event are selected at random. Use a suitable approximation to find the probability that more than 50 of these competitors had times less than 36.0 minutes.
